They teach children important skills

Children learn responsibility through caring for pets. They understand that their pet is dependent on them for water, food and exercise. They also become aware of the responsibilities of owning a pet, such as taking them to the vet and making financial decisions about the needs of the animal. Children also learn about time management by helping with daily chores like bathing, feeding walking, and cleaning the cage. They also learn how important it is to prioritize these tasks over other activities such as watching TV or playing.

Children who have pets often develop close relationships with them. This can aid in their development as children and self-esteem. They can talk to them and play with them and share their secrets. They are unconditionally affectionate towards their pets and return the love. This is especially crucial for children who are the only ones in their family or the youngest.

In addition to learning about the importance of responsibility, children can gain compassion and empathy from their relationship with a pet. Their pets care about them regardless of their behavior and helps children understand the importance of treating others with kindness and compassion. Additionally, their pets show them what it's like to grow old and die, which could teach children about the process of getting older.

Pets can also encourage a sense of belonging and community among children. When a child is part of an animal-friendly family, they often become more close to their parents, siblings and other family members. These relationships can help them develop a positive sense of identity and help them improve their social skills.

A pet can also teach a child the importance of protecting the environment and the natural world. They will learn about the importance of habitat conservation and how animals are dependent on each other to survive. They are also taught to respect the living things around them and realize that we all belong to a global community.

It is crucial to consider a child's level of maturity and skill before adopting an animal. Children who are younger than 10 may not be able to take care of a large dog, or any other exotic pet. They may still be able to have low-maintenance pets, such as goldfish or hamsters.

Mental health is improved by the use of these products

Pets can aid people suffering from mental health issues, such as depression and anxiety. They can provide comfort, companionship and playfulness. They also reduce stress and encourage exercise. In addition, they can improve social interaction and create a sense of belonging. Pets also reduce feelings of loneliness and depression, according to research.

In the 2016 HABRI study the researchers surveyed those who were diagnosed with a mental illness and pets in their home. Participants were asked to write about their experiences with their pets and how they impacted their lives. The results revealed that pets made them feel more secure and have a greater sense of self-worth and enhanced their ability to manage their mental illness. They also reported that they felt less lonely.

In addition, the presence of a pet can reduce stress and improve the quality of sleep. A pet can also serve as an escape from distressing symptoms such as hearing voices or suicidal thoughts.
